| 20 | package org.apache.james.jdkim.canon; |
| 21 | |
| 22 | import java.io.FilterOutputStream; |
| 23 | import java.io.IOException; |
| 24 | import java.io.OutputStream; |
| 25 | |
| 26 | /** |
| 27 | * Pass data to the underlying system until a given amount of bytes is reached. |
| 28 | */ |
| 29 | public class LimitedOutputStream extends FilterOutputStream { |
| 30 | |
| 31 | private int limit; |
| 32 | private int computedBytes; |
| 33 | |
| 34 | /** |
| 35 | * @param out |
| 36 | * an output stream that will receive the "trucated" stream. |
| 37 | * @param limit |
| 38 | * a positive integer of the number of bytes to be passed to |
| 39 | * the underlying stream |
| 40 | */ |
| 41 | public LimitedOutputStream(OutputStream out, int limit) { |
| 42 | super(out); |
| 43 | this.limit = limit; |
| 44 | this.computedBytes = 0; |
| 45 | } |
| 46 | |
| 47 | public void write(byte[] b, int off, int len) throws IOException { |
| 48 | if (len > limit - computedBytes) { |
| 49 | len = limit - computedBytes; |
| 50 | } |
| 51 | if (len > 0) { |
| 52 | out.write(b, off, len); |
| 53 | computedBytes += len; |
| 54 | } |
| 55 | } |
| 56 | |
| 57 | public void write(int b) throws IOException { |
| 58 | if (computedBytes < limit) { |
| 59 | out.write(b); |
| 60 | computedBytes++; |
| 61 | } |
| 62 | } |
| 63 | |
| 64 | /** |
| 65 | * @return the number of bytes passed to the underlying stream |
| 66 | */ |
| 67 | public int getComputedBytes() { |
| 68 | return computedBytes; |
| 69 | } |
| 70 | |
| 71 | /** |
| 72 | * @return true if the limit has been reached and no data is being passed to |
| 73 | * the underlying stream. |
| 74 | */ |
| 75 | public boolean isLimited() { |
| 76 | return computedBytes >= limit; |
| 77 | } |
| 78 | } |
